About this carrier
ARUR TRANSPORT LTD is a Surrey, BC freight carrier that is authorized for property in the state of British Columbia. This company has 4 truck(s) in their fleet and 4 truck drivers. Their motor carrier number is MC-421379 and their USDOT number is 990551.
